We did this trail on Saturday and it is most scenic! There are lots of panoramic views and beautiful woods together with a small gorge and micro waterfalls. As a word of warning, the description in the White Mountain Guide is accurate but has almost British understatement of the difficulties.

In particular, the North fork of the trail up the headwall of Goose Eye Cirque is not well suited for descent. We went up this way, difficult enough, but encountered a group who intended to hike down it and later encountered two members of this group who were on their way to get a litter for an injured (ankle) hiker and told us "You went the right way!".
